This is common dilemma faced by majority of engineering graduates in final year of their studies. If you are technically inclined and want to make career in the technical field then it is advisable to do M.Tech/MS. If you want to be a generalist then MBA is better option. Nowadays Technical specialists are paid very well and sometimes more than Management graduates. Equal growth opportunities are available for both M.Tech and MBA graduates.

Hi,
Air hostess as a career is highly remunerative and prestigious. Although salaries of an air hostess depend upon the airlines she is employed in, but the starting salary may vary from Rs. 25,000 to Rs. 40,000 per month in domestic airlines. An air hostess working with international airlines receives higher salary as compared to the domestic airlines. The salary of a senior air hostess is about Rs. 60,000-80,000 per month in public sector airlines and Rs. 2-3 lakhs in private international airlines.

Not many colleges or Universities in India offer an MBA- LLB dual dsegree program. However the Singhania University situated at Pacheri Bari, Distt. Jhunjhunu (Rajasthan) does. Singhania University is a fully recognized university as per Sec. 2f of the UGC Act 1956. The eligibility for the dual degree program requires the candidate to have passed Graduation degree from any recognized university. The duration is for 4 years and the fees is Rs. 1,08,000.00 per Year. You may check the official website for more information http://www.singhaniauniversity.co.in/ .
